The Opportunity:
The mission of the Warehouse Assistant is to assist and ensure all outbound shipments are completed in an accurate, timely, cost effective manner. You will be an integral part of a warehouse team that is responsible for the fulfillment of Pela Case products shipping directly to our customers all over the world. In this position you will be highly accurate, proficient in shipping, order packing and warehousing practices, while being a self-starter who thrives in an environment of continuous improvement and problem-solving. Teamwork and the adaptability to pitch in where needed will be critical to your success. Working in a fast-paced environment and delivering on promises nurtures your soul. The days of work will include Saturday-Monday with an increasing schedule as we enter our peak season. There is flexibility in the hours needed.
Responsibilities:
- Pick, process and ship orders accurately, quickly and according to Pela's standards
- Assemble product packaging, prepare orders & labels for shipping
- Sort and organize stock in the warehouse with equipment and by hand
- Organize and prep daily shipments with each carrier
- Maintain warehouse including putting away stock, sweeping, organizing supplies, and garbage disposal
- Assist in inventory counts on finished good and packaging materials
- Receive incoming supplies and products
- Maintain a safe and clean workspace
- Ensure safe operation of all equipment, follow all protocols for warehouse safety
- Assist others as necessary
